摘要
目的研究miR-205对人皮肤黑素瘤细胞系A375的侵袭能力和MMP2,MMP9的影响,探讨miR-205影响黑色素细胞侵袭的机制。方法将miR-205 mimics用阳离子脂质体LipofectamineTM2000转染A375细胞,Transwell侵袭实验检测细胞侵袭能力变化,Western blot和ELISA检测MMP2和MMP9蛋白表达变化。结果 Transwell侵袭实验显示转染miR-205 mimics后细胞的穿膜数(75.21±11.32)明显低于空白对照组(133.20±8.69)及阴性对照组(128.90±7.03),Western blot和ELISA结果均证实miR-205 mimics能明显减低MMP2/9蛋白表达,以上差异均有统计学意义(P均<0.05)。结论 miR-205可能通过减低MMP2和MMP9表达抑制黑素瘤细胞的侵袭能力。
Objective To investigate the effects of miR-205 on invasion and MMP2 and MMP9 expression in human skin malignant melanoma cell lines A375 and further elucidate its action mechanisms. Methods miR-205 mimics were transfected A375 by lipofectamine package. Cell invasion was studied by transwell invasion as- say. MMP2 and MMP9 proteins expression were investigated by western blot and ELISA. Results Transwell invasion assay demonstrated the number of A375 cells in miR-205 mimics group was significantly lower (75.21 + 11.32) than that in control group (133.20 + 8.69) and negative control group (128.90 + 7.03 ) at 48h after transfeetion. Western blot and ELISA confirmed that miR-205 mimics could significantly inhibit the expressions of MMP2/9 protein and secreting. Conclusion miR-205 inhibit the invaion of human skin ma- lignant melanoma cell may be through reduce the expression of MMP2 and MMP9.
